Video games offer the potential of “experiential medicine”

Scientists at UC San Francisco's Neuroscape Center have developed video game interventions that improve key aspects of cognition in aging adults, including short-term memory, attention and long-term memory. The games use adaptive closed-loop algorithms to challenge players, keeping them engaged while adapting difficulty levels.

Ethnicity, poverty, low community involvement linked to lasting loneliness

A study of 641 participants found that midlife and older Hispanic/Latinx adults were more likely to experience prolonged loneliness, with 16% persistently lonely. Elevated tween screen time linked to disruptive behavior disorders

A new study by University of California - San Francisco-led researchers found that tweens who spend more time on screens have a higher likelihood of developing disruptive behavior disorders. Overlooked proteins may be key to better diagnosis of Alzheimer’s

A recent study at UC San Francisco discovered that fragmented tau protein in diseased neurons could be a new target for existing drugs, potentially improving diagnosis and treatment of Alzheimer's. The researchers found that measuring the fragments in cerebrospinal fluid may help distinguish between different forms of dementia.

Many residents won’t get abortion training if Roe is overturned

A new study by UCSF and UCLA finds that nearly half of US OB-GYN residency programs may lack abortion training if Roe v. Wade is overturned, posing significant risks for patient care.
